China continues its false propaganda about East Turkistan in Africa.

China continues to intensify its fake propaganda campaign in various countries aimed at concealing the genocidal crimes in East Turkistan. Pro-China official Erkin Tuniyaz visited Ethiopia and Zambia last week.

According to the Chinese media outlet Tengritag (Tianshan), the deputy secretary of the so-called "Party Committee of the Xinjiang Uyghur Autonomous Region" and puppet chairman Erkin Tuniyaz formed a delegation. They visited Ethiopia and Zambia from May 11 to 18. He also visited the headquarters of the African Union.

The report claimed that the purpose of this visit was to expand cooperation with countries participating in the Belt and Road Initiative in Africa, "tell the story of Xinjiang well," and "present Xinjiang's image," further confirming that this visit was merely a fake propaganda campaign.

During this period, Erkin Tuniyaz met with African Union officials and leaders of both countries, held a so-called "coordination meeting between local Xinjiang and Ethiopian enterprises," and signed cooperation agreements with several companies and states.

During his visit, Tuniyaz also sought to achieve his primary goal of whitewashing the genocidal crimes in East Turkistan, repeating China's claims of comprehensive "Xinjiang governance measures," economic development, social stability, human rights guarantees, ethnic unity, religious harmony, and other false claims.

For years, China has intensified its false propaganda regarding East Turkistan by sending delegations to various countries and organising planned visits by foreign delegations to East Turkistan to cover up its crimes. For example, a Gambian journalist delegation visited East Turkistan from May 8 to 12, in line with China's disinformation campaign.

A 2022 report published by the Australian Strategic Policy Institute (ASPI) stated that Chinese outward-looking propaganda has been effective in the Middle East and Africa. The report indicated that, through its anti-racism and anti-colonial propaganda in Middle Eastern and African countries, China is attempting to shift the blame onto Western countries and distract them from the East Turkistan issue.
